Opera Mini 4 beta goes live

By: | Jun 19th, 2007 at 03:34PM
  Comments
Filed Under: News

Opera released the beta version of their Opera Mini 4 mobile browser this morning. The browser is available for just about any handset you can imagine, and brings a simple, straightforward option to the mobile browsing fold. Opera Mini is a popular alternative to terrible built in WAP browsers that now come standard with most web-enabled handsets. The new version of their mobile browser provides a number of exciting enhancements, including a virtual mouse mode, and a Desktop Layout mode that provides a bird’s eye view of your favorite sites. Both of these features , combined with a slick "Intelligent Zoom" feature, make browsing the "real" internet on your mobile phone a realistic option. If you feel like being a guinea pig for Opera’s beta test, the public version is available right now from their mobile site.
